ГОСТ Р ИСО/МЭК 10746-3-2001
- создание идентификатора для интерфейса управления капсулой;
- создание контролирующего интерфейса капсулы для новой капсулы в ядре;
- создание идентификатора контролирующего интерфейса капсулы.
Контролирующий интерфейс капсулы, созданный при реализации шаблона капсулы, позволяет удалять капсулу (например, при отказе менеджера).
Удаление капсулы удаляет все объекты в капсуле.
12.2 Функция управления объектом
Создает контрольные точки и удаляет объекты.
Когда объект относится к кластеру, который может быть деактивирован, для которого может быть создана контрольная точка или который может мигрировать, объект должен иметь интерфейс управления объектом, обеспечивающий одну или несколько из следующих функций:
- создание контрольной точки объекта;
- удаление объекта.
Примечания
1 Таким образом разные интерфейсы управления объектами могут иметь разные типы интерфейсов в зависимости от того, какие функции они поддерживают.
2 Создание контрольной точки объекта дает информации, подходящую для ввода в контрольную точку кластера.
3 При удалении объекта заглушки, связники, протокольные объекты и пересечения, поддерживающие его связывания, могут быть удалены.
Функция управления объектом используется функцией управления кластером.
12.3 Функция управления кластером
Создает контрольные точки, восстанавливает, мигрирует, деактивирует и удаляет кластеры и предоставляется каждым менеджером кластера через интерфейс управления кластером, охватывающий одну или несколько из следующих функций относительно управляемого кластера:
- изменение политики управления кластером (например, в отношении размещения контрольных точек этого кластера, использования функции перемещения для переключения реактивации или восстановления кластера);
- деактивация кластера;
- создание контрольной точки кластера;
- замена кластера новым, реализованным из контрольной точки кластера (т.е., удаление с последующим восстановлением);
- миграция кластера в другую капсулу (используя функцию миграции);
- удаление кластера.
Примечание — Таким образом разные интерфейсы управления кластерами могут иметь разные типы интерфейсов в зависимости от того, какие функции они поддерживают.
Поведение менеджера кластера ограничено политикой управления для этого кластера. Создание контрольной точки кластера и деактивация возможны только если объекты в кластере имеют интерфейсы управления объектами, поддерживающие функцию создания контрольной точки объекта. Деактивация и удаление кластера требуют, чтобы объекты в кластере поддерживали удаление объектов.
В архитектуре, определенной в настоящей базовой модели, функция управления кластером:
- используется функциями управления капсулой, деактивации и реактивации, создания контрольной точки и восстановления, миграции и управления указателями инженерных интерфейсов;
- использует функцию сохранения для хранения контрольных точек.
12.3.1 Создание контрольной точки кластера
Контрольная точка кластера содержит информацию, необходимую для переустановки кластера, и включает в себя следующие элементы:
а) контрольные точки объектов в кластере;
б) конфигурацию объектов в кластере;
в) информацию, достаточную для переустановки распределенных связываний, в которых участвуют объекты кластера.
Примечание — Указатели инженерных интерфейсов являются существенной частью информации, требуемой для установления связываний. Контрольная точка кластера должна содержать все указатели инженерных интерфейсов, вытекающие из перечислений а) и в).
12.3.2 Удаление, деактивация и отказ кластера
Удаление кластера представляет собой удаление всех объектов в кластере, менеджера кластера
33